Discussion and Vote: Budget Transfers – Contingency (City Center) (13-466)
Commissioner Madigan moved and Commissioner Franck seconded to approve the 2013 budget
transfers – contingency – City Center that were made available with the agenda materials. The City

Center is looking to use $1500 from its contingency line for professional services contracts. This
has been approved by the City Center Authority. The current amount in the contingency line is
$2,511.02; after this transfer, the amount in the contingency line will be $1,011.02.
Ayes - All
Discussion and Vote: Budget Transfers – Contingency (Fire Admin) (13-467)
Commissioner Madigan advised this request is to transfer $92,490 to the general expense lines for the fire
chief and assistant fire chief payroll items from the general fund contingency line. This is for retroactive
pay owed for the recently negotiated Fire Chiefs Unit contract.
Commissioner Madigan moved and Commissioner Franck seconded to approve the 2013 budget
transfers – contingency - fire admin - as distributed with the agenda. The current budget amount in
the contingency line is $155,230.24; there will remain $62,740.24 after these transfers.
Ayes - All
Discussion and Vote: Budget Transfers – Contingency (PO Admin) (13-468)
Commissioner Madigan advised this request is to transfer $57,540 to general fund expense lines for the
police chief, assistant chief, and captain payroll items from the general fund contingency line. This is for
retroactive pay owed per the Police Admin Unit contract that may be signed before year end.
Commissioner Madigan moved and Commissioner Franck seconded to approve the 2013 budget
transfers – contingency – Police Admin – as distributed with the agenda. The current budget
amount in the contingency line is $62,740.24; there will remain $5,200.24 after these transfers.
Commissioner Mathiesen asked what happens to the funds if the contract is not signed.
Commissioner Madigan advised this is being set up to be signed by the end of the year. This will set us up
to be able to use these funds if the contract is signed.
Ayes - All
